    Hi guys,

    From Yonex website, BG63 is the thickest string (0.74mm) compared to bg65 (0.70mm). It doesn't seem to be very popular in the forum.

    It's weird but after trying all type of string from Yonex (Bg65,70,80,85,65ti,68ti,66) I realized I was more confortable with thick string at high tension. That's why I'm so interested about this string.

    Anyone ever tried, any reviews?
